Speaking of being handcuffed to the CoP, that sort of happened to me once. There was a child (who I think was probably autistic) who started screaming and had to get off the ride. Apparently, opening the exit door messes with the ride operation, so everyone had to re-watch the scene they just saw. Then some people who were already regretting having gone on CoP decided that it was the perfect time to bail, so they went out the door... causing us to have to re-watch the scene again. Then more people headed for the door, with the CMs pleading with everyone to STAY SEATED, until they gave up and announced that they would be rotating the theater mid-scene as long as everyone would just STAY SEATED.
